WebDec 1, 2024 · The tetanus and diphtheria vaccine (also called Td) is used to help prevent these diseases. This vaccine helps your body develop immunity to the disease, but will not treat an active infection you already have. Td vaccine is for use in adults and children at least 7 years old. WebThe Td vaccine is an immunization against the bacterial diseases tetanus and diphtheria for people who are between the ages of 7 and 64 years old. It is given in a single 0.5-mL shot in the upper arm. Td vaccines have a full-strength dose of tetanus (T) toxoids and a lower-strength dose of diphtheria (d) toxoids. What are Td vaccine names?
